Patent number: 11892031Abstract: A compressor includes a housing, a shaft that is rotated relative to the housing to compress a working fluid, and a foil bearing that supports the shaft. The foil bearing includes a top foil. The foil bearing is a foil gas bearing that is backed up by a ball bearing, or a mesh foil bearing with an actuator to compress a wire mesh dampener. A heat transfer circuit includes a compressor and a working fluid. The compressor includes a shaft that is rotated to compress the working fluid, and a foil bearing for supporting the shaft as it rotates.Type: GrantFiled: January 30, 2023Date of Patent: February 6, 2024Assignee: TRANE INTERNATIONAL INC.Inventors: Sung Hwa Jeung, Charles Roesler, Donald Lee Hill, Jay H. Patent number: 11867230Abstract: A porous gas bearing is disclosed. The porous gas bearing includes a housing having a fluid inlet and an aperture. A porous surface layer is disposed within the housing surrounding the aperture in a circumferential direction. The porous surface layer is in fluid communication with the fluid inlet. A damping system includes a damping system including a biasing member, the biasing member being disposed in a passageway that extends along the longitudinal direction of the aperture and circumferentially about the aperture, wherein the biasing member is arranged radially outward from the porous surface layer.Type: GrantFiled: October 17, 2022Date of Patent: January 9, 2024Assignee: TRANE INTERNATIONAL INC.Inventors: Sung Hwa Jeung, Jay H. Patent number: 10753392Abstract: A porous gas bearing is disclosed. The porous gas bearing includes a housing having a fluid inlet and an aperture. A porous surface layer is disposed within the housing surrounding the aperture in a circumferential direction. The porous surface layer includes a plurality of segments arranged in a longitudinal direction of the aperture. The porous surface layer is in fluid communication with the fluid inlet. A damping system includes a plurality of dampers. The plurality of dampers is disposed circumferentially about the aperture. The plurality of dampers is arranged in between a first segment of the plurality of segments of the porous surface layer and a second segment of the plurality of segments of the porous surface layer.Type: GrantFiled: June 11, 2018Date of Patent: August 25, 2020Assignee: TRANE INTERNATIONAL INC.Inventors: Sung Hwa Jeung, Jay H.
